]> git.donarmstrong.com Git - qmk_firmware.git/commitdiff
Renamed jd40's LAYOUT to LAYOUT_kc (#3000)
authorMechMerlin <30334081+mechmerlin@users.noreply.github.com>
Sat, 19 May 2018 04:00:48 +0000 (21:00 -0700)
committerDrashna Jaelre <drashna@live.com>
Sat, 19 May 2018 04:00:48 +0000 (21:00 -0700)
Made a new LAYOUT without all the KC_##

keyboards/jd40/jd40.h
keyboards/jd40/keymaps/default/keymap.c

index 0000bc7ed9ef855cbcdc65ca748060667aac3318..3ed6149f05a9b6a06edbe9112115eab884b8ab49 100644 (file)
@@ -4,7 +4,7 @@
 #include "quantum.h"
 #include "led.h"
 
-/* GH60 LEDs 
+/* GH60 LEDs
  *   GPIO pads
  *   0 F7 WASD LEDs
  *   1 F6 ESC LED
@@ -13,7 +13,7 @@
  *   B2 Capslock LED
  *   B0 not connected
  */
+
  /*
 inline void gh60_caps_led_on(void)      { DDRB |=  (1<<2); PORTB &= ~(1<<2); }
 inline void gh60_poker_leds_on(void)    { DDRF |=  (1<<4); PORTF &= ~(1<<4); }
@@ -30,7 +30,7 @@ inline void gh60_wasd_leds_off(void)          { DDRF &= ~(1<<7); PORTF &= ~(1<<7); }
 
 /* JD40 MKII keymap definition macro
  */
-#define LAYOUT( \
+#define LAYOUT_kc( \
     K01, K02, K03, K04, K05, K06, K07, K08, K09, K10, K11, K12, \
        K13, K14, K15, K16, K17, K18, K19, K20, K21, K22, K23, \
        K24, K25, K26, K27, K28, K29, K30, K31, K32, K33, K34, \
@@ -42,4 +42,16 @@ inline void gh60_wasd_leds_off(void)         { DDRF &= ~(1<<7); PORTF &= ~(1<<7); }
     { KC_##K35, KC_##K36, KC_##K37, KC_##K38, KC_##K39, KC_NO,    KC_##K40, KC_##K41, KC_##K42, KC_##K43, KC_##K44, KC_NO    }  \
 }
 
+#define LAYOUT( \
+    K01, K02, K03, K04, K05, K06, K07, K08, K09, K10, K11, K12, \
+       K13, K14, K15, K16, K17, K18, K19, K20, K21, K22, K23, \
+       K24, K25, K26, K27, K28, K29, K30, K31, K32, K33, K34, \
+       K35, K36, K37, K38, K39, K40, K41, K42, K43, K44 \
+) { \
+    { K01, K02, K03, K04, K05, K06, K07, K08, K09, K10, K11, K12 }, \
+    { K13, K14, K15, K16, K17, K18, K19, K20, K21, K22, K23, KC_NO    }, \
+    { K24, K25, K26, K27, K28, K29, K30, K31, K32, K33, K34, KC_NO    }, \
+    { K35, K36, K37, K38, K39, KC_NO,    K40, K41, K42, K43, K44, KC_NO    }  \
+}
+
 #endif
index b8cff95ac46d964c5872c026adc9688044b6cac6..b4ec05505300e9d54b53bc94cb3ba4b6978727e3 100644 (file)
@@ -7,25 +7,25 @@
 #define _UL 3
 
 const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= {
-    [_BL] = LAYOUT(
+    [_BL] = LAYOUT_kc(
         F12, Q, W, E, R, T, Y, U, I, O, P, BSPC,
         TAB, A, S, D, F, G, H, J, K, L, ENT,
         LSFT, Z, X, C, V, B, N, M, COMM, UP, DOT,
         LCTL, LGUI, LALT, FN0, SPC, SPC, FN0, LEFT, DOWN, RIGHT),
 
-    [_AL] = LAYOUT(
+    [_AL] = LAYOUT_kc(
         GRV, F1, F2, F3, F4, F5, F6, F7, F8, F9, F10, DEL,
         CAPS, 1, 2, 3, 4, 5, 6, 7, 8, 9, 0,
         T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, SCLN, PGUP, QUOT,
         TRNS, TRNS, TRNS, TRNS, FN3, FN3, TRNS, HOME, PGDN, END),
 
-    [_FL] = LAYOUT(
+    [_FL] = LAYOUT_kc(
         T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S,
         T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S,
         T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S,
         T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S),
 
-    [_UL] = LAYOUT(
+    [_UL] = LAYOUT_kc(
         T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S,
         TRNS, FN4, FN5, FN11, FN10,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S,
         T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S, TRNS,